Book description
Introducing UNACO - the United Nations Anti Crime Organisation - an
elite team of agents who battle the world's deadliest criminals. When
the mission looks impossible, the world calls upon UNACO.
The most ingenious criminal in the world has come up with his most
spectacular exploit, to kidnap the mother of the president of the United
States and hold her and the Eiffel Tower to ransom.
He hires for his team:
• a top weapons expert, who can steal and use the newest, most secret
military equipment
• the best cat burglar, who can scale any heights
• a man whose extraordinary strength and ingenuity will conquer any obstacle.
Faced with this audacious crime of the century, the world's top
politicians can only turn to UNACO and its team. 'A magnificent

to tell.' Daily Express Alistair MacLean, the son of a Scots minister,
was brought up in the Scottish Highlands. In 1941 he joined the Royal
Navy. The two and a half years he spent aboard a wartime cruiser gave
him the background for HMS Ulysses, his remarkably successful first
novel, published in 1955. He is now recognized as one of the outstanding
popular writers of the 20th century, the author of 29 worldwide
bestsellers, many of which have been filmed.
